Since the final assessment to the benefitted owners is less than the preliminary assessment roll, the <br />only alternative presented is to approve the final assessment roll. <br />It is recommended that the final assessment roll and the "As -Built Resolution" for the paving of the <br />above mentioned road be approved by the Board of County Commissioners and that it be transferred <br />to the Department of Utility Services for billing and collection. <br />ON MOTION by Commissioner Stanbridge, <br />SECONDED by Commissioner Ginn, the Board <br />unanimously adopted Resolution 2000-128 <br />certifying "as -built" costs for certain paving and <br />drainage improvements to 1t Street between 16th <br />Avenue and 18' Avenue, designated as Project No. <br />9721. <br />As -Built (Fourth Reso.) 3/25/97(ENG)RES4.MAG\gk <br />RESOLUTION NO. 2000- 128 <br />A RESOLUTION OF INDIAN RIVER COUNTY CERTIFYING <br />"AS -BUILT" COSTS FOR CERTAIN PAVING AND <br />DRAINAGE IMPROVEMENTS TO is` STREET BETWEEN <br />16TH AVENUE AND 18TH AVENUE, DESIGNATED AS <br />PROJECT NO. 9721, AND OTHER CONSTRUCTION - — <br />NECESSITATED BY SUCH PROJECT; PROVIDING FOR <br />FORMAL COMPLETION DATE, AND DATE FOR PAYMENT <br />WITHOUT PENALTY AND INTEREST. <br />WHEREAS, the Board of County Commissioners of Indian River County <br />determined that the improvements described herein specially benefitted the property located <br />within the boundaries as described in this title, designated as Project No. 9721, are in the public <br />interest and promote the public welfare of the county; and <br />WHEREAS, on April 6, 1999, the Board held a public hearing in the <br />Commission Chambers at which time the owners of the property to be assessed were afforded an <br />opportunity to appear before the Board to be heard as to the propriety and advisability of making <br />such improvements; and <br />OCTOBER 10, 2000 <br />-57- <br />001K 115 PG 454 <br />
